Elmer Watts C
70-79
Elmer Watts
# 314 of 601
55:26 Stage Race

Challenge Totals

Miles 43
Calories 1,487
Score 5,170,790
1 of 1 Completed!
Tour
Time
Outlaw Rock
Outlaw Rock
10.0 mi
55:26